Additional Information

1. Only one of them had the knowledge of screening policy by means of hearsay.

2. None of them had the knowledge of forced or mandatory repatriation before departure of VN.

3. As reported by the boatmaster, he knew that the control of Sino-Vio tnamese Dorder was only tigthened to those who

could not speak Chinese fluently. And tho border was still open.

4. No ex-serviceman, serviceman or civil servant was encountered.

5. No PRC officials was encountered on their way to long Kong.

6. Total no. of unaccompanied minor under the age of 18 : Nil.

7. They had no knowledge of being placed on a deserted island after arrival.

8. They chose to come llong Kong as they believed that they would be arranged to settle overse:s. expensive for exodus as compared with other destinations, such as halaysia and Philippines.

And it was less

9. Two CIIs were refused permission to land in Ilong Kong on 6-12-09 at 1530 hrs. They were handed over to CSD(CIRC)

on 6-12-89 at 1540 hrs. and were subsequently escorted by larine Polios to SUL pending their repatriation to China.
